WebMar 19, 2024 · Start by peeling the onions, and then chop or slice as desired. Place them in an airtight container, freezer bag, or wrap them tightly in aluminum foil or plastic wrap. Raw onions will last up to eight months in the freezer . Cooked onions can be frozen for up to 12 months when stored in an airtight container or freezer bag. Quartering an onion (depending on the size of the onion) is probably the smallest you should do. WebDec 2, 2024 · Sweated onions are never browned. Cook until translucent. If you keep cooking the onions for another few minutes, they will start to lose their opacity and become come translucent. The moisture will evaporate and the onions will wilt further. Keep stirring and adjusting the flame so that the onions cook, but again, do not let them brown. how to replace sink drain trap

The … north bend urgent care hoursWebJan 28, 2014 · The prettiest of all the onions, red onions have deep purple skin and a mild flavor. They're best raw in salads, salsas, and as a toppings on burgers and sandwiches because of how mild they are. They can be used in cooked dishes as well, but the onion flavor isn't nearly as strong when they're cooked.
